Responsibilities:
- Hands-on investigation: Meticulously examine customer-returned devices using technical tools and logic to find the exact root cause of an issue.
- Data sleuthing: Use MS Excel and internal systems to log findings, identify emerging quality trends, and spot patterns others might miss.
- Quality advocacy: Participate in "Continuous Improvement" projects, using your findings to influence future product design and manufacturing.
- Global collaboration: Share insights with international teams to ensure corrective actions are implemented across the organisation.
- Technical reporting: Translate complex findings into clear, concise reports that meet strict regulatory and safety standards.
